2017-08-11 41 views
1

在WSO2用戶訂閱是否有類似RemoteUserStoreManagerService目前在WSO2 APIM 1.10得到什麼API是由特定用戶發佈,哪些API他訂閱信息的任何管理服務?如何讓發佈的內容的API,使用管理服務

我知道我們可以從數據庫中獲得這一信息,但我想用管理服務。

感謝,桑托斯

回答

0

可以在APIM 1.10.0使用Store Jaggery APIs這一點。

要獲取用戶john創建的所有的API。

1)登錄爲admin用戶(或誰擁有兩個出版商和存儲訪問的任何其他用戶)

curl -X POST -c cookies http://localhost:9763/store/site/blocks/user/login/ajax/login.jag -d 'action=login&username=admin&password=admin' 

2)搜索由john發佈的API。

curl -X POST -b cookies "http://localhost:9763/store/site/blocks/search/api-search/ajax/search.jag" -d "action=searchAPIs&query=provider:john&start=0&end=3" 

讓所有的API認購用戶john

1)用戶身份登錄john

curl -X POST -c cookies http://localhost:9763/store/site/blocks/user/login/ajax/login.jag -d 'action=login&username=john&password=pass' 

2)獲取所有訂閱

curl -b cookies http://localhost:9763/store/site/blocks/subscription/subscription-list/ajax/subscription-list.jag?action=getAllSubscriptions 
相關問題